Table 3 Multivariable logistic regression of early risk factors for ARDS in sepsis cohort

From: Early risk factors and the role of fluid administration in developing acute respiratory distress syndrome in septic patients

 

Odds ratio (95% CI)

p value

APACHE II

1.10 (1.07–1.13)

<0.001

Age (years)

0.97 (0.96–0.98)

<0.001

Total fluid infused during first 6 h (L)

1.15 (1.03–1.29)

0.01

Shock

2.57 (1.62–4.08)

<0.001

Gender (male)

1.30 (0.92–1.85)

0.14

Race

  

 White

Reference

Reference

 Black

0.56 (0.36–0.87)

0.08

 Asian

1.14 (0.32–4.11)

0.58

 Other

1.14 (0.66–1.96)

0.29

Pneumonia as site of infection

2.31 (1.59–3.36)

<0.001

Pancreatitis

3.86 (1.33–11.24)

0.01

Acute abdomen

3.77 (1.37–10.41)

0.01

Diabetes mellitus

0.74 (0.48–1.12)

0.16

Tachypnea (RR > 30)

1.41 (1.00–1.97)

0.05

  1. For continuous variables, the odds ratio indicates the increased odds of ARDS for a 1-unit increase in the variable
  2. APACHE Acute Physiology and Chronic Health Evaluation, RR respiratory rate
